Grammar Patterns
((sth.)) to convert (sth.) into a sequence of bytes We need to serialize the data.
((sth.)) to publish (sth.) as a series The magazine will serialize the novel.

Etymology
From 'serial' + the verb-forming suffix '-ize', meaning 'to make into'.
Memory Tips
To 'make' something into a 'series'. This applies to both data (a series of bytes) and stories (a series of parts).
